private void button3_Click(object sender, EventArgs e) { bool[] numerico = new bool[] { true }; // Para verificar si es numerico numerico[0] = Numerico.EsNumerico(textBox1.Text.Trim()); if (textBox1.Text.Trim() != "") { if (numerico[0] == true) { if (dataGridViewcambio.SelectedRows.Count == 1) { int id = Convert.ToInt32(dataGridViewcambio.CurrentRow.Cells[0].Value); ProductoSelect = TablaUsuario.ObtenerUsuario(id); this.Close(); } else { MessageBox.Show("Debe de seleccionar una fila"); } } else { MessageBox.Show("El campo de texto con asterisco, Deben de ser numeros enteros"); } } else { MessageBox.Show("Debe de rellenar los campos con asterisco"); } }
public static int AgregarUsuario(Responsable pResponsable) { int retorno = 0; MySqlCommand comando = new MySqlCommand(string.Format("INSERT INTO `responsable`(`idResponsable`, `Nombre`, `Alias`, `Password`, `Puesto`, `FechaIngreso`, `HoraIngreso`, `CORREO`) VALUES ('{0}','{1}','{2}','{3}','{4}',CURRENT_DATE(), CURRENT_TIME(),'{5}')", pResponsable.idResponsable, pResponsable.Nombre, pResponsable.Alias, Cryptography.Encrypt(pResponsable.Password), pResponsable.Puesto, pResponsable.Correo), BDConexion.ObtenerConexion()); retorno = comando.ExecuteNonQuery(); return(retorno); }
public static int Actualizar(Responsable pResponsable) { int retorno = 0; MySqlConnection conexion = BDConexion.ObtenerConexion(); // UPDATE `responsable` SET `Puesto` = 'Almacenista', `HoraIngreso` = '14:13:22' WHERE `responsable`.`idResponsable` = 2 //UPDATE `responsable` SET `Nombre`='{0}',`Alias`='{1}',`Password`='{2}',`Puesto`='{3}',`FechaIngreso`='{4}',`HoraIngreso`='{5}' WHERE `responsable`.`idResponsable` = {6} MySqlCommand comando = new MySqlCommand(string.Format("UPDATE `responsable` SET `Nombre`='{0}',`Alias`='{1}',`Password`= MD5('{2}'),`Puesto`='{3}', `CORREO`='{4}' WHERE `responsable`.`idResponsable` = {5}", pResponsable.Nombre, pResponsable.Alias, pResponsable.Password, pResponsable.Puesto, pResponsable.Correo, pResponsable.idResponsable), conexion); retorno = comando.ExecuteNonQuery(); conexion.Close(); return(retorno); }
public static Responsable ObtenerUsuario(int pidResponsable) { Responsable pResponsable = new Responsable(); MySqlConnection conexion = BDConexion.ObtenerConexion(); //SELECT `idResponsable`, `Nombre`, `Alias`, `Password`, `Puesto`, `FechaIngreso`, `HoraIngreso` FROM `responsable` WHERE `responsable`.`idResponsable` = 1 MySqlCommand _comando = new MySqlCommand(String.Format("SELECT `idResponsable`, `Nombre`, `Alias`, `Password`, `Puesto`, `FechaIngreso`, `HoraIngreso`, `CORREO` FROM `responsable` WHERE `responsable`.`idResponsable` = {0}", pidResponsable), conexion); MySqlDataReader _reader = _comando.ExecuteReader(); while (_reader.Read()) { pResponsable.idResponsable = _reader.GetInt32(0); pResponsable.Nombre = _reader.GetString(1); pResponsable.Alias = _reader.GetString(2); pResponsable.Password = _reader.GetString(3); pResponsable.Puesto = _reader.GetString(4); pResponsable.FechaIngreso = _reader.GetString(5); pResponsable.HoraIngreso = _reader.GetString(6); pResponsable.Correo = _reader.GetString(7); } conexion.Close(); return(pResponsable); }
public static List <Responsable> Buscar(string pidResponsable) { List <Responsable> _lista = new List <Responsable>(); MySqlCommand _comando = new MySqlCommand(String.Format( "SELECT `idResponsable`, `Nombre`, `Alias`, `Password`, `Puesto`, `FechaIngreso`, `HoraIngreso`, `CORREO` FROM `responsable` WHERE `responsable`.`idResponsable` = {0}", pidResponsable), BDConexion.ObtenerConexion()); MySqlDataReader _reader = _comando.ExecuteReader(); while (_reader.Read()) { Responsable pResponsable = new Responsable(); pResponsable.idResponsable = _reader.GetInt32(0); pResponsable.Nombre = _reader.GetString(1); pResponsable.Alias = _reader.GetString(2); pResponsable.Password = _reader.GetString(3); pResponsable.Puesto = _reader.GetString(4); pResponsable.FechaIngreso = _reader.GetString(5); pResponsable.HoraIngreso = _reader.GetString(6); pResponsable.Correo = _reader.GetString(7); _lista.Add(pResponsable); } return(_lista); }